**Vendor note: Inkmill markdown pipeline**

Rendering for Parchway docs is outsourced to Inkmill under an annual contract, renewing each March. They handle sanitization and PDF export; we own the upload queue. SLA: 4-hour response on rendering failures. Escalate only after two failed retries. Their support desk is reachable at the address below.

billing contact of hahaf-baguf = zorael.tammir.jorius@sivrelhq.internal

## Launch Plan: Verracut 2 (Managers Only)

Verracut 2 enters limited release in Hallowmere and Dunsfield markets first, with full rollout eight weeks later. Pricing mirrors the original line; marketing spend is front-loaded into the first month. Inventory staging is complete at the Rexton warehouse. The confidential note below records the board-approved strategic intent.

board note of kagep-yahig: Only 9 of the 120 pilot accounts renewed Quenix, so a churn review is set for April 1.

# Paritywick — Limits & Quotas

The rate-parity checker polls partner channels on a fixed cadence; exceeding crawl quotas gets us throttled for 24h, so respect the caps. Per-property scans are serialized, and retries back off exponentially. If the queue depth alarm fires, lower concurrency before touching timeouts. Changes require a note in the ops log. Current limits are defined below.

constants for bagag-fawip:
BUDGETS = {
    "wenius": 400,
    "brieth": 224,
    "rusath": 783,
    "eliys": 187,
    "aldax": 737,
    "ralion": 818,
    "istius": 153,
}

Handover note for the incoming contractor: the GraphQL N+1 fix on Orchardwire is mostly done. I added a batched dataloader for the `memberships` resolver, which cut query counts from ~400 to 3 per request. Remaining work: apply the same pattern to `invoiceLines` and add regression tests. Staging access for verification is gated; sign in to the Orchardwire staging console with the passphrase below.

vault phrase of bagaf-kajeg = jorath-feniel-briir-siliel-ralix